The Snake and the Crane

A street artist in Chicago decides to quit his programming job to pursue being an artist as a career despite a string of smaller shows which garnered little interest. He meets a wealthy gallery owner named Michelle Werner and, after a show at her prominent gallery in the city, critics and journalists begin to notice him but he's not sure if he can cut it in the world of high art. He loses control and realizes that maybe what he sought was all just a lie, success in the art world seems superficial and once he loses his anonymity, his life continues to spiral down both physically and mentally. It is a world where few can be trusted and Mads realizes the machine may chew him up like it has so many others.
